Stadium
is a football stadium in , with a capacity of 27,111, which has been the home of Charlton Athletic Football Club since 1919, with a period of exile between 1923 and 1924, and from 1985 to 1992. is situated 3,100 feet southeast of Vaizeys Wharf.

Railway station
Pontoon Dock is a station on the Docklands Light Railway in in east , which is on the Woolwich Arsenal branch, opened on 2 December 2005. is situated 3,200 feet north of Vaizeys Wharf.
